Fall Parent/Teacher Conferences
The sign-up for our fall Parent/Teacher Conference will be open to parents this Monday, October 5th at 8:00 a.m. Please click on the link below for directions to our sign-up platform “Meet the Teacher” in order to sign-up. When signing up, parents will need to indicate whether they plan to attend the conference in person or would prefer a conference via Zoom. Conferences will be scheduled for 20 minutes, with 15 minutes of that time being used for the conference and 5 minutes being used for cleaning between conferences. All parents coming in for in-person conferences will be required to complete a COVID screener before being allowed to enter and must be wearing a mask. Please access the document, print and complete, and bring it with you to the conferences. We will continue to practice social distancing guidelines. Also, we are trying to limit the number of people in the building on these days, therefore, two parents will be permitted to attend per child. However, children will not be permitted to enter the building on these days. As a result, if this is not possible for your family, please sign-up for a Zoom conference.

When parents log on to Meet the Teacher, they will be able to sign-up for conferences for multiple children and for any staff member that works with their child including our art, gym, music, STEM and library teachers. Conferences with specials teachers are not required but are an option we are offering to parents. In addition, all related services staff members will meet with parents separately from the conferences with classroom teachers. As a result, parents can also schedule conference times with our Social Worker, Speech and Language Pathologist, Reading Resource Teachers, English Learner Teacher, Special Education Resource Teachers, and our Extended Teacher. It is highly recommended that parents meet with any related service staff member who works with their child.
Conferences are being held on Wednesday, October 14th from 4-8 p.m. and Thursday, October 15th from 12-7 p.m. Please be sure to plan accordingly in order to attend conferences during the days that have been designated by the district for teachers to meet with parents. This is valuable time to discuss the individual growth and skills of your child, as well as, work together with the teacher to plan and set goals toward your child’s individual progress.
Preparing for the Switch to Hybrid Learning
As we are making plans for the return of our students in the hybrid learning model, there are several things parents can do to help prepare for their child’s transition as well! Please check out the list below:
Have your child practice wearing a mask for extended periods of time, as students will be required to wear a mask for the duration of the time they are in the building.
Make sure your child has their I.D. and red coil with the holder for their I.D., as these will be scanned to ensure that students have a completed COVID Screener and can enter the building quickly upon arrival.
Bookmark the COVID-19 Symptom Screener health.barrington220.org, to easily access it each morning and certify your child prior to their arrival
Consider an organization system for your child’s supplies/materials to be transported to and from school, as students will need many of the supplies we sent home at the beginning of the year for learning at school on their in-person days.
